Matthew McConaughey looked unrecognisable in his breakout role from the 1993 cult favourite Dazed and Confused. 

The Hollywood actor, 55, who was only 23-years-old at the time, looked worlds away from himself as he rocked long straight blond locks as he portrayed David Wooderson.

His character in the coming-of-age comedy was an older teenager that still hung out with the high school students in the film.

Despite Matthew going on to make a name for himself, at the time, the film earned a disappointing $8.25 million worldwide at cinemas after its September 1993 debut. 

However, it has since secured its position on numerous ‘greatest high school films’ rankings. 

Set around the final day of term in a relaxed Texan community in 1976, Dazed and Confused chronicles a collection of secondary school pupils – year 11s progressing to year 12 and year 8s transitioning to secondary education.

It follows the teens manoeuvring the edge of maturity as they discover themselves immersed in the depths of teenage years in 1970s America. 

They celebrate, engage in initiation ceremonies, exhibit characteristic youthful defiance and anxiety, and ponder their destinies – all whilst consuming cannabis and drinking substantial quantities of alcohol, reports the Express.

Joining Matthew in the cast was none other than Ben Affleck, as well as Parker Posey, Milla Jovovich, Adam Goldberg, Cole Hauser, Nicky Katt, Joey Lauren Adams, Rory Cochrane, and Anthony Rapp.

Dazed and Confused has also received a 94 per cent review rating on Rotten Tomatoes.

 Reviewers wrote: ‘Richard Linklaters cinematic flashback… captures a rich pageant of high-school life, circa 1976, in a mere 100 minutes, leaning on nostalgia without wallowing in it’;

‘Totally authentic. Every time you watch this film, you’re taken back to the 1970s daze of high school. The ’70s kids AMERICAN GRAFFITI’; 

‘The movie’s vibe is warm and good-natured, and we feel welcomed into the world of the cool older kids’.

McConaughey and Alves have chosen to raise their family in the actor’s native Texas and away from the hustle and bustle of Hollywood.

To keep their family life more private, they are rarely seen together in public, although an exception was made earlier this year when all of them attended the annual Mack, Jack & McConaughey Gala in Austin earlier this year. 

McConaughey has been a strong proponent of bringing more film and TV production to Texas.  He and longtime friend Woody Harrelson, are the executive producers of comedy called Brothers, loosely based on their actual friendship.

The premise is that the two fictional siblings test the bounds of their relationship as they ‘combined families attempt to live together on Matthew’s ranch in Texas.’

Eight of the 10 episodes had been filmed before production came to a halt after the exit of the showrunner due to creative differences, according to Variety.

Levi McConaughey made his feature film debut in The Lost Bus, with his dad starring as the driver a school bus who attempts to rescue stranded elementary school students from a deadly fire.
